Taxonomic Classification
| Rank | Blicks Grasratte | Galapagos-Schildreisratte |
|---|---|---|
| Kingdom same | Animalia (Tier) | Animalia (Tier) |
| Phylum same | Chordata (Chordatiere) | Chordata (Chordatiere) |
| Class same | Mammalia (Säugetiere) | Mammalia (Säugetiere) |
| Order same | Rodentia (Nagetiere) | Rodentia (Nagetiere) |
| Family | Muridae (Mice & Rats) | Cricetidae |
| Genus | Arvicanthis | Aegialomys |
| Species | Arvicanthis blicki | Aegialomys galapagoensis |
Evolutionary Relationship
Blicks Grasratte and Galapagos-Schildreisratte share a common ancestor at the Order level: Rodentia. (Nagetiere)
